Shady Point is moderately more affordable than Cleo Springs, with a 8.7% lower cost of living index. Cleo Springs scores 64 compared to 59 for Shady Point, where the US average is 100. This difference means residents of Cleo Springs can expect to pay noticeably more for everyday expenses, housing, and services.

On the housing front, median rent in Cleo Springs is $830/month compared to $638/month in Shady Point — a 30% difference. Interestingly, home values tell a different story: while Shady Point has cheaper rent, Cleo Springs actually has lower median home values ($88,500 vs $97,500).

Median household income in Cleo Springs is $43,571 compared to $47,212 in Shady Point (-7.7%). Shady Point offers a double advantage: higher earnings combined with a lower cost of living, giving residents significantly more purchasing power. Looking at affordability, residents of Cleo Springs spend roughly 22.9% of their income on rent, more than the 16.2% in Shady Point.
